Hi All, Could anyone offer me some advice please? I would like to sell my 3 One arm bandits, and have watched the Elephant House auctions website for a couple of years, but I notice on here they don't always attract favourable reviews or comments. So my question is, is it advisable to take them to Elephant house to be sold at Auction, or would it be better to put them up for sale on Ebay, and possibly offer a delivery option to the buyer if the buyer was within 50 or so miles of my own address(Lincoln area)? Also, could anyone tell me the "selling fees" at Elephant house as I do not seem to be able to find the figure in the "Q&A" page.
Many thanks in advance to any replies.

Nothing wrong with the Elephant House at all, there will be a few that disagree, but that is up to them. Been to nearly all of Steve’s auctions and offers a sterling service, even collects machines at a small fee. Charges 5% commission for sellers.

Your problem is it has not operated since November due to health concerns, which I hope is going well, so do not know if and when this will restart.

There is the Coventry auction in November, annual event run by collectors

eBay is a pain in the butt as you get machines removed without licence at £25 a pop and limited to two licenses per year.

You could advertise on here or the many Facebook groups people seem to have turned to...
